MCM/CoAct is a specialist youth provider for Inclusive Employment Australia supporting young people with disability up to the age of 25 to find and keep meaningful employment.
The Team Leader supervises up to eight staff members, offering immediate guidance, filling in for roles as needed, and ensuring operational consistency. Team Leaders play a dual role, supporting staff with day-to-day questions, performance coaching, and troubleshooting service delivery issues while also maintaining an operational presence by providing backup for roles such as Employment Support Consultants, Workforce Retention Consultants, or Diversity Recruitment Specialists.
